Overview
Presents accessible experiences as examples for the principles of the text
Details principles and techniques from diverse program structures to craft appropriate practices for a wide variety of individual settings
Introduces the concept that interdependence is necessary for a socially sustainable education praxis and examines the notions around education as a commodity and motifs for exporting education programs as commodities
Offers specific strategies and tools for all phases of design and delivery of international adult education
